Error 5 Out Of Memory
Contents |
log in tour help Tour Start here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ies gta 5 out of memory error of this site About Us Learn more about Stack Overflow the company iphone 5 out of memory Business Learn more about hiring developers or posting ads with us Database Administrators Questions Tags Users Badges Unanswered Ask reason 5 out of memory Question _ Database Administrators Stack Exchange is a question and answer site for database professionals who wish to improve their database skills and learn from others in the community. Join them; my iphone 5 is out of memory it only takes a minute: Sign up Here's how it works: Anybody can ask a question Anybody can answer The best answers are voted up and rise to the top Why does MySQL say I'm out of memory? up vote 8 down vote favorite 7 I was trying to execute a fairly large INSERT...SELECT in MySQL with JDBC, and I got the following
Mysql Out Of Memory Error
exception: Exception in thread "main" java.sql.SQLException: Out of memory (Needed 1073741824 bytes) at com.mysql.jdbc.SQLError.createSQLException(SQLError.java:1073) Since I'm not actually returning a ResultSet object, I thought the Java heap space shouldn't be an issue. However, I tried to up it anyway and it did no good. I then tried to execute the statement in MySQL Workbench and I got essentially the same thing: Error Code 5: Out of memory (Needed 1073741816 bytes) I should have plenty of RAM to complete these operations (enough to fit the whole table I'm selecting from), but I'm guessing there are various settings I need to tweak to take advantage of all my memory. I'm running an Amazon EC2 High Memory Double Extra Large Instance with a Windows Server 2008 AMI. I've tried fiddling with the my.ini file to use better settings, but for all I know I might have made things worse. Here's a dump of that file: [client] port=3306 [mysql] default-character-set=latin1 [mysqld] port=3306 basedir="C:/Program Files/MySQL/MySQL Server 5.5/" datadir="C:/ProgramData/MySQL/MySQL Server 5.5/Data/" character-set-server=latin1 default-storage-engine=INNODB sql-mode="STRICT_TRANS_TABLES,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ION" max_connections=100 query_cache_size=1024M table_cache=256 tmp_table_size=25G thread_cache_size=8 myisam_max_sort_file_size=100G myisam_repair_threads = 2 myisam_sort_buffer_size=10G key_buffer_size=5000M bulk_insert_buffer_size = 4000M read_buffer_size=8000M read_rnd_buffer_size=8000M sort_buffer_size=1G innodb_ad
Community Podcasts MySQL.com Downloads Documentation Section Menu: MySQL Forums :: General :: ERROR 5 (HY000): Out of memory New Topic Advanced Search ERROR 5
Mysql Out Of Memory (needed Bytes)
(HY000): Out of memory Posted by: Julien Lamarche () Date: August mysqld out of memory (needed bytes) 05, 2011 02:29PM Running a CiviCRM query at http://pastebin.com/6M1emH14, I get ERROR 5 (HY000): Out of memory java.sql.sqlexception: out of memory mysql (Needed 1640964 bytes) Though I can submit a query change recommendation to CiviCRM, I'm hoping this can be fixed by adding an index or changing a parameter in http://dba.stackexchange.com/questions/1927/why-does-mysql-say-im-out-of-memory the my.cnf file. Should I increase key_buffer_size or table_cache or is it another parameter? An InnoDB parameter perhaps (CiviCRM tables are all InnoDB)? +----+--------------------+-----------------------------------------+-----------------+------------------------------------------------------------------------------------+------------------+---------+---------------------------+--------+------------------------------+ | id | select_type | table | type | possible_keys | key | key_len | ref | rows | Extra | +----+--------------------+-----------------------------------------+-----------------+------------------------------------------------------------------------------------+------------------+---------+---------------------------+--------+------------------------------+ | 1 | PRIMARY | contact_a | index | NULL | http://forums.mysql.com/read.php?20,429609,429609 index_is_deleted | 1 | NULL | 149732 | Using index; Using temporary | | 1 | PRIMARY | civicrm_group_contact-605 | ref | UI_contact_group | UI_contact_group | 4 | step2_crm_db.contact_a.id | 1 | Distinct | | 1 | PRIMARY | civicrm_group_contact-608 | ref | UI_contact_group | UI_contact_group | 4 | step2_crm_db.contact_a.id | 1 | Distinct | | 1 | PRIMARY | civicrm_group_contact-612 | ref | UI_contact_group | UI_contact_group | 4 | step2_crm_db.contact_a.id | 1 | Using where; Distinct | | 7 | DEPENDENT SUBQUERY | civicrm_group_contact | unique_subquery | UI_contact_group,FK_civicrm_group_contact_group_id | UI_contact_group | 8 | func,const | 1 | Using where | | 6 | DEPENDENT SUBQUERY | civicrm_value_1_riding__circonscription | eq_ref | unique_entity_id,FK_civicrm_value_1_riding__circonscription_entity_id,INDEX_riding | unique_entity_id | 4 | func | 1 | Using where; Using temporary | | 6 | DEPENDENT SUBQUERY | contact_a | eq_ref | PRIMARY | PRIMARY | 4 | func | 1 | Using where; Using index | | 5 | DEPENDENT SUBQUERY | civicrm_group_contact | unique_subquery | UI_contact_group,FK_civicrm_group_contact_group_id | UI_contact_group | 8 | fu
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n more about http://stackoverflow.com/questions/7472884/what-is-sql-error-5-sqlstate-hy000-and-what-can-cause-this-error Stack Overflow the company Business Learn more about hiring developers or posting ads with http://stackoverflow.com/questions/21448501/out-of-memory-neeeded-xxxxxxxx-bytes us Stack Overflow Questions Jobs Documentation Tags Users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 4.7 million programmers, just like you, helping each other. Join them; it only takes a minute: Sign up What is SQL Error: 5, SQLState: HY000? and what can cause this error? up out of vote 0 down vote favorite The application I'm debugging writes randomly/occasionally this exception in its logs. org.hibernate.util.JDBCExceptionReporter - SQL Error: 5, SQLState: HY000 and an SQL out of memory error associated to this. While I found in mysql documentation what SQLState: HY000 is, I can't find anywhere what SQL Error 5 is, related to this state. Currently I know only that the db connection closes due to this out of out of memory memory error, and that the situation doesn't follow any pattern. Due to the nature of the program adding additional logging messages is not an option. (I can't do that as the application is huge and from what I've seen it happens randomly - different memory size needed for the queries to execute (in the messages) varying from 3 MB to 6 MB). Any help/information about this exception is appreciated. Additional information: It seems that the out of memory messages come in blocks of 6-50+ requests in an interval of 100-150 milliseconds. From a list of about 20-30 error messages, only 3 also appeared in mysql logs, the rest only in tomcat logs (printed the stacktrace). Thanks mysql sql hibernate out-of-memory share|improve this question edited Sep 20 '11 at 8:55 asked Sep 19 '11 at 14:55 Romeo 142217 add a comment| 1 Answer 1 active oldest votes up vote 1 down vote accepted HY000 means general error. SQL Error 5 is Out of memory. Review your query, increase buffers in my.ini. Also make sure to repair all your tables and re-index them. See: http://dev.mysql.com/doc/refman/5.0/en/error-messages-server.html share|improve this answer answered Sep 19 '11 at 15:09 Johan 48.8k16105201 Thanks for helping me on the number 5 mistery I had. Unfortunately I
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n more about Stack Overflow the company Business Learn more about hiring developers or posting ads with us Stack Overflow Questions Jobs Documentation Tags Users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 4.7 million programmers, just like you, helping each other. Join them; it only takes a minute: Sign up Out of memory (Neeeded xxxxxxxx bytes) [closed] up vote -2 down vote favorite I ran a query from MySQL server with big data. It works in development (But the table is not as big as production). Now when I migrate it into Production, it seems like out of memory Out of memory (Needed 89684760 bytes) Which setting I can change to increase the memory limit for MySQL? I still got enough space on my server to utilize. I tried to limit it works, but somehow my application need all the data... I use MySQL 4.1 and also tried for increase key buffer size and sort buffer size but no works mysql performance configuration settings share|improve this question edited Jan 30 '14 at 5:29 Nagaraj S 7,14051636 asked Jan 30 '14 at 5:26 Daniel Robertus 905921 closed as off-topic by John3136, karthik, lpapp, Madara Uchiha♦, derobert Feb 28 '14 at 10:22 This question appears to be off-topic. The users who voted to close gave this specific reason:"Questions on professional server- or networking-related infrastructure administration are off-topic for Stack Overflow unless they directly involve programming or programming tools. You may be able to get help on Server Fault." – John3136, karthik, lpapp, Madara Uchiha, derobertIf this question can be reworded to fit the rules in the help center, please edit the question. The MySQL 4.1 branch died 5 years ago. For God's sake stop using it. –Madara Uchiha♦